top of page
  • 作家相片Nan Weng

业务分析员(BA)到底是干啥的?

作者:翁楠,CareerCamp 专家导师团专家导师


作为项目里的业务分析员 (Business Analyst, BA),我好像很难和别人解释清楚我到底是干啥的,尤其是对项目管理不熟悉的人。当我说,我是金融行业里的业务分析员的时候,往往有人会问我,最近股市咋样啊?这支股票该买吗?什么时候卖好呢?

让我在这里再试试解释一下吧。先来介绍一下我的同事们:

  1. 项目经理 - 他们认为凑足9个女人可以1个月把孩子生出来;

  2. 开发部经理 - 他们会计划18个月来生个孩子;

  3. 项目联络员 - 不管怎样,他们的“生孩子”项目计划书里只会写上9个月;

  4. 营运部经理 - 他们觉得只要女人足够努力,1个女人1个月生9个孩子也是可能的;

  5. 高管 - 认为他自己1个人就能生出孩子,用不着别的什么男人和女人;

  6. 人事部经理 - 他们往往在孩子都生出来了才招到一个完美的男人;

  7. 质检部经理 - 他们无论如何都不会满意生出来的孩子, 把每一个可疑的地方记录成缺陷;然而,开发部经理会立马反击,那些都不是缺陷,而是没有记录在案的特质,并拍胸脯保证他们生出的孩子绝对是完美无暇的;

  8. 项目发起人 - 他们到最后总是会宣布孩子成功的诞生了!没有超时, 没有多花钱;

  9. 最后是客户 - 他们拿到孩子时一脸懵逼,我要个孩子做啥?!

这是一些行业内的笑话,网上流传着很多版本。做项目的老兵们看到这样的调侃,一般都是会心的一笑;尽管夸张但反映了一些事实。从这些笑话里,您或许能了解到一个项目里的主要成员,并看出他们的一些特质。但这中间没有我哦,那么我就来个狗尾续貂:


10. 业务分析员 - 就是能了解到客户真实需求的人; 如果他们在大家忙着“生孩子”之前就介入,和客户有效沟通,就会发现客户其实真正需要的并不是一个孩子,而是一个机器宠物!


玩笑而已,不想我那些曾经的同事们觉得被冒犯,不单因为他们都是很棒的专业人士,更因为我还得在业界混不少年才能退休呢。


一个项目得以顺利完成,需要团队里每个人的通力合作。不过这篇文章我只是想着重讲讲业务分析员的职责。


15年前,我考了全球认证的“项目管理专业人士” 证书。通过学习和实践,我对项目管理的理解可以用一句话来高度概括,就是:


计划需要完成的工作,再完成计划好的工作

(Plan the work and work the plan)


这里的头半句“需要完成的工作” (the work) , 就是真正的客户需求。请注意,不是客户“想要”什么,而是“需要”什么!这是业务分析员要通过和客户的有效沟通而发掘出来的,并且负责让项目里的相关人员都清楚这些需求。项目里的相关人员包括项目团队里的人(上述的10类人),还包括或多或少受项目执行过程和最终结果影响的所有部门及人员。


后半句里的,“完成计划好的工作”(work the plan),是指项目执行并最终将符合需求的产品交付给客户的这个过程。业务分析员在这个过程中也起到了关键的作用。他们要负责和项目里的所有相关人员不断沟通,让大家的认知一直保持一致;尤其在执行过程中,当需求发生变化的时候, 业务分析员的作用至关重要。


因为他们对客户需求是最清楚、理解最深刻的,当有歧义和争议的时候,得由业务分析员来澄清。比如有关“孩子”的“缺陷”还是“特质”的争论,最后往往是业务分析员根据客户需求来一锤定音。在项目收尾阶段,业务分析员要帮助客户来检验产品是否符合需要,并帮助他们为开始使用新产品而做好准备。


有些公司除了业务分析员,还有一个位置,叫业务系统分析员(Business System Analyst, BSA),往往设在技术部门。业务系统分析员的职责,是把客户需求转化成更具体的技术指标,把需要“做什么”(what)转化成“怎么做”(how)。这两个位置我都做过,有时候在一个项目里身兼二职。以后可以专门写一篇文章来谈谈这两个位置之间的相关性和不同点。


不同于持续进行的运营性质的工作,项目是有始有终的。除了有时间因素,项目还会受资金及人员的限制。下面这张图显示了这几个方面的关系。



三角型的三个边分别是时间(schedule)、资金(budget)、 和人员(resource),中间的圆代表项目的核心,即项目的范围(scope)。项目范围决定了项目的时限、资金量、 和人员配置;项目范围(scope)又是由客户需求(business requirements)来设定的;客户需求则是由业务分析员来负责的。我总算把自己放进了项目管理的图表里。


如果项目的时间、资金、 或人员安排得不合理,那么客户需求就不能“圆”满的按质按量的完成,就像下面这个图表里的“圆”被挤变了型。现实和理想往往是有差距的。


尽管我这十几年都是在金融公司里做项目,项目管理的方法论放在所有行业都适用。一个好的业务分析员应该是能够:

  1. 发现客户的真正需求,而不是停留在客户要什么的层面上;这要求很强的分析和沟通能力,还有扎实的行业知识及敏锐的洞察力

  2. 清晰和有效的表述客户需求 (语言往往最容易产生歧义,可以多运用图表,比如上面这几个完美的图);SMART的客户需求是高质量产品的基石((SMART 为首字母缩写:Specific明确、Measurable可检测、Achievable可实现、Realistic切合实际、Timely有时效)

  3. 为整个项目从头至尾提供帮助,从分析需求、计划、实施、检测, 到最后交付,业务分析员起到的是桥梁作用,并用具体的内容来引领项目,而不是靠头衔 (BA leads the project through content, not through authority)

有句俗语说“魔鬼藏于细节之中”( devils are in the details), 业务分析员的日常工作就是非常之细致,所以每天都要和一帮"魔鬼们”打交道。


希望您看了这篇文章以后,不会再问我股市如何了,我要是知道股市的走向,就不用做成天和 “魔鬼”打交道的业务分析员了嘛!

bottom of page